Output 04266fa0520238e2e0fa6811a7f46c91aa0edd257926748ce645b7598536126b:1

value
370600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8997a5b7c32d077b528e42cbf187b1838118cc3 OP_EQUAL
address
DMyAjPchduccLk2Lzbecot717NyrQipAy8
transaction
04266fa0520238e2e0fa6811a7f46c91aa0edd257926748ce645b7598536126b
spent
true